The United Nations University Institute for the Advanced Study of Sustainability (UNU-IAS) in Tokyo, Japan, is offering the 2026 Sustainability Scholarship for postgraduate students from developing countries. This opportunity is open for both MSc and PhD degree programmes in Sustainability Science, aiming to train future policymakers and researchers to address global sustainability challenges. The UNU-IAS programmes provide a unique international learning environment within the UN system, with collaborative research and practical experience at the heart of the curriculum.
Students can choose from thematic areas such as Governance for Climate Change and Sustainable Development, Biodiversity & Society, Water & Resource Management, and Innovation & Education. The curriculum is designed to equip students with the knowledge and practical skills necessary to solve sustainability challenges, and students are expected to propose and conduct research in one of these areas. The faculty includes UNU-IAS academic staff and distinguished visiting scholars, ensuring a high-quality academic experience.
The scholarship covers full tuition, visa fees, travel costs, and provides an annual stipend of $9,948. Applicants must be from developing countries and demonstrate a strong academic interest in sustainability, research skills, and motivation to contribute to global environmental and societal solutions. The application process requires submission of a research proposal aligned with UNU-IAS thematic areas, along with other supporting documents. The deadline for applications is June 28, 2026.
